灯具及其可拆卸式安装结构
【技术领域】
本发明涉及照明领域,尤其是指其灯体可拆卸式安装的灯具及该灯具的可拆卸式安装结构。
【背景技术】
现有的灯具包括壳体、灯体和灯座,壳体安装在天花或墙体内,灯体安装在灯座后通过锁定装置固定在壳体内。所述锁定装置包括壳体内的周向凸环、与凸环相配的支承体,支承体内设有搁置灯体与灯座的周向凸环、侧表面上设有凸起,所述壳体内的周向凸环设有与凸起相配的缺口。当支承体侧表面上的凸起穿过缺口、卡在壳体内的周向凸环时,所述灯体与灯座就固定在壳体内。另外,所述的支承体可由异形弹簧来代替,异形弹簧沿径向设有向外凸的凸起,当凸起卡在壳体侧面上的通孔时,所述灯体与灯座就固定在壳体内。然而,综观上述灯具的结构,光源安装和更换比较麻烦,灯具大量更换灯泡时更是如此。
因此,提供一种拆装结构简单、光源更换方便的灯具实为必要。
【发明内容】
本发明的目的在于提供一种拆装结构简单、光源更换方便的灯具及该灯具的可拆卸式安装结构。
为实现本发明目的,提供以下技术方案:
本发明灯具的可拆卸式安装结构,其包括相配合的卡爪组件和卡勾,所述卡爪组件包括壳体以及置于壳体内的卡爪本体,卡爪本体一端设有一对与卡勾配合的卡爪,卡爪上设有第一导引块和第二导引块,在第一导引块两侧开设有第一滑道和第二滑道,在第一导引块和第二导引块之间设有第三滑道,在该壳体上设有一端固定的触发杆,该触发杆另一端所设置的活动范围是可沿第一滑道滑至第三滑道,并可沿第三滑道滑至第二滑道,在壳体与卡爪本体之间设有复位弹簧。
该卡勾一般为箭头形结构,当卡勾推进卡爪时,将卡爪及卡爪本体整体往壳体内推进,固定在壳体上的触发杆沿第一滑道滑行至第三滑道,最后触发杆停留在第一导引块和第二导引块之间的第三滑道中,触发杆的作用力克服复位弹簧力将卡爪本体固定住,从而使卡爪两端卡紧卡勾。
可以通过第一导引块和第二导引块与触发杆的相对位置的设定来实现触发杆的上述运动轨迹。
也可以通过设计第一导引块和第二导引块的特定结构来实现该运动轨迹。该第一导引块顶端两侧设有不对称斜面(分别是面向第一滑道和第二滑道),该第一导引块的底端也设有不对称斜面。该第二导引块指向该第一导引块的底端,该第二导引块顶端也设有不对称斜面。通过所述不对称斜面对触发杆的导引作用来实现触发杆的上述运动轨迹。
进一步的,该壳体上设有滑槽,该卡爪本体上相应设有与之配合的第一凸块,该第一凸块上设有导引斜面。从而将卡爪本体可滑动地固定在壳体上。
进一步的,该壳体内设有定位杆,所述复位弹簧套在定位杆上;进一步的,该卡爪本体上设有开孔,该定位杆插入开孔中,从而利于稳定卡爪本体的运动轨迹。
本发明还提供一种灯具,该灯具可以是一般灯具,或一般嵌入式灯具,其包括灯体和灯座,或者是设有筒罩的嵌入式防火灯具,该灯具进一步包括上述的可拆卸式安装结构。对于一般灯具和一般嵌入式灯具,所述卡勾和卡爪组件相配合的分别固定在灯体或灯座上;对于嵌入式防火灯具,所述卡勾和卡爪组件还可以相配合的分别固定在灯体或筒罩上,该卡爪组件可以安装在筒罩的筒壁上,或该卡爪组件安装在筒罩顶部,相应地卡勾也安装在灯体顶部;对于嵌入式防火灯具,所述卡勾和卡爪组件也可以相配合的分别固定在灯体或灯座上。
该卡勾可以通过一体成型工艺或通过铆接或螺钉固定的方式固定在灯体上。该卡爪组件也可以通过铆接或螺钉固定的方式固定在灯座或筒罩上。进一步的,该卡爪组件也可以通过这样的方式安装:在该壳体上设有第二凸块,该第二凸块上设有导引斜面,在所述灯座或筒罩上相应设有与该第二凸块配合的固定结构,该固定结构可以是与第二凸块相配合的开孔、开槽、滑槽,或者是固定块等。
该装有可拆卸式安装结构的灯具可以设有两个或以上所述的可拆卸式安装结构,也可以仅设一个所述的可拆卸式安装结构,例如在嵌入式防火灯具的应用中灯体与筒罩的安装配合,灯体的一侧设有所述可拆卸式安装结构的卡勾,相对应的筒罩的一侧内壁设有卡爪组件,灯体的另一侧可以通过铰接或插销的形式与筒罩另一侧连接在一起。
对比现有技术,本发明具有以下优点:
本发明拆装结构简单、光源更换方便,采用该可拆卸式安装结构的灯具,只要对灯体施加推力即可实现灯体与灯座或灯罩之间的固定安装,同理,在拆卸时,也仅仅是轻便的推动灯体即可实现,操作过程十分简单方便,方便于灯源的安装和更换,有效的提高了安装人员的工作效率,大大的减少了安装费用。

【具体实施方式】
请参阅图1~3,本发明可拆卸式安装结构包括相配合的卡爪组件和卡勾,所述卡爪组件包括壳体1以及置于壳体内的卡爪本体2,卡爪本体一端设有一对与卡勾配合的卡爪3,卡爪上设有第一导引块4和第二导引块5,在第一导引块两侧开设有第一滑道41和第二滑道42,在第一导引块和第二导引块之间设有第三滑道43,在该壳体上设有一端固定的触发杆6,在壳体与卡爪本体之间设有复位弹簧8。
该卡勾7一般为箭头形结构,如图4所示。当卡勾7推进卡爪3时,将卡爪3及卡爪本体2整体往壳体1内推进,固定在壳体上的触发杆6沿第一滑道41滑行至第三滑道43,最后触发杆停留在第一导引块和第二导引块之间的第三滑道中,触发杆6的作用力克服复位弹簧力8将卡爪本体2固定住,从而使卡爪两端卡紧卡勾。
请参阅图2和图3,该第一导引块4顶端两侧设有不对称斜面(分别是面向第一滑道和第二滑道),该第一导引块的底端也设有不对称斜面。该第二导引块5指向该第一导引块4的底端,该第二导引块顶端也设有不对称斜面。通过所述不对称斜面对触发杆的导引作用来实现触发杆的上述运动轨迹。
该壳体上设有滑槽11,该卡爪本体2上相应设有与之配合的第一凸块21,该第一凸块上设有导引斜面,从而将卡爪本体可滑动地固定在壳体上。
该壳体内设有定位杆12,所述复位弹簧8套在定位杆12上;该卡爪本体上设有开孔22,该定位杆插入开孔中,从而利于稳定卡爪本体的运动轨迹。
本发明采用上述可拆卸式安装结构的灯具可以是一般嵌入式灯具,其包括灯体和灯座。
或者是设有筒罩的嵌入式防火灯具,如图4~6所示。对于一般嵌入式灯具,所述卡勾和卡爪组件相配合的分别固定在灯体或灯座上;对于嵌入式防火灯具,所述卡勾和卡爪组件相配合的分别固定在灯体或筒罩上。
该卡勾可以通过一体成型工艺或通过铆接或螺钉固定的方式固定在灯体上。该卡爪组件也可以通过铆接或螺钉固定的方式固定在灯座或筒罩上。
如图4、5所示,结合参考图1~3,该卡爪组件也可以通过这样的方式安装:在该壳体上设有第二凸块13,该第二凸块上设有导引斜面,在所述灯座或筒罩上相应设有与该第二凸块配合的固定结构,该固定结构为与第二凸块相配合的滑槽,滑槽低端设有突出的固定块,通过第二凸块和固定块的配合将卡爪组件固定在滑槽内。
